Deep Chocolate Layer Cake: Submitted by: Grandmother's Kitchen | Date Added: 20 Oct 2014 Ingredients:

Cake
2 cups white sugar
1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
3/4 cup cocoa powder
1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
2 large eggs
1 cup whole milk
1/2 cup vegetable oil
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 cup boiling water

Icing
1/4 c water
1 c sugar
5 egg whites
1/4 c sugar
1 cup butter, softened, cut into small pieces
1 tsp vanilla

Syrup
3/4 cup sugar
1/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ons cocoa
1/2 cup water
dash of salt
1/2 teaspoon vanilla

Cooking Instructions:

Heat the oven to 350°F. Grease and flour three 9-inch round baking pans.

Stir together sugar, flour, cocoa, baking powder, baking soda and salt in a large mixer bowl. Add eggs, milk, oil and vanilla; beat with a mixer on medium speed for 2 minutes. Mix in boiling water. Divide the batter evenly between the prepared pans.

Bake 30 to 35 minutes or until wooden pick inserted in center of each cake comes out clean.

Set the pans on wire racks and cool 10 mins. before removing from pans.
